Lonnie Felty

Lonnie Felty, 90, of Beaver Dam, passed away, Thursday, May 24, 2012 at Ohio County Hospital in Hartford. He was born August 31, 1921 in Ohio County to the late Lum and Nora Whitaker Felty. He was a farmer and a member of New Harmony Baptist Church in Butler County., where he served as a deacon.
Beside his parents he was preceded in death by three sisters and five brothers.
Survivors include his wife of 65 years, Clarice L. Ferguson Felty of Beaver Dam, three daughters, Joyce A. Taylor of Bowling Green, Kay Sapp of Bowling Green, and Teresa (Bobby) Barrow of Quality. He was blessed with six grandchildren, Kara Taylor of Bowling Green, Rebecca Johnson of Beaver Dam, Alyssa (John) O’Driscoll of Randolph, MA, Ashton Barrow of Bowling Green, Brett Barrow and Bethany Barrow both of Quality, and two great grandchildren, Kylie Johnson and Avery Johnson both of Beaver Dam.
Funeral service will be held at 2:00 PM, Sunday, May 27, 2012 at William L. Danks Funeral Home in Beaver Dam. Burial will be in Sunnyside Cemetery in Beaver Dam. Visitation will be from 5-8PM, Saturday and 12 PM until time of service Sunday at the funeral home.

Expression of sympathy may take the form of contributions to Hospice of Ohio County or American Heart Association. Envelopes will be available at the funeral home.
